2 18-0334 Approve Art in Private Development Project - T2 Development (AC Hotel
by Marriott) 795 S. Fair Oaks Ave.
Community Services Coordinator, Kristin Dance, offered a staff recommendation to
approve the artwork as proposed.
Ms. Dance introduced Mr. Steve Dolan, art consultant from Andrea Schwartz
Gallery to the Commission. Mr. Dolan provided a presentation on the proposed
artwork to be located at 795 S. Fair Oaks Avenue. The proposed three dimensional
art piece is created by artist David Franklin. The presentation reviewed the site
specifics such as placement of the proposed artwork on the hotel property,
consideration of vehicular traffic and visibility, the use of LED lighting and the
surrounding landscape.
Temporary Chair Kiphuth inquired about children's safety around the art piece and
whether birds on the art piece would be addressed. Mr. Dolan responded that the
railing on the artwork is designed to have 4-5 inches of space in between them and
the art piece is less inviting to birds since there is no top plate sitting on top of the
art piece. The aluminum art piece can also be washed down with a waterhose if
needed.
Commissioner Rogers commented that the art piece is a dynamic abstract and
asked if the sculpture had any sharp edges or if it would heat up and be hot if
touched. Mr. Dolan replied that the sculpture will not have sharp edges and the art
City of Sunnyvale Page 2
Arts Commission Meeting Minutes - Final April 18, 2018
piece will be set into the landscaping and not directly on the hotel patio. He
indicated the art piece would not heat up.
Temporary Chair Kiphuth asked about visual traffic concerns. Ms. Dance replied
that the City's Planning Department had no traffic concerns after reviewing the
proposal.
Commissioner Eskridge commented that the art piece would be a beautiful
enhancement to the City of Sunnyvale and would be highly visible. Temporary Chair
Kiphuth moved and Commissioner Rogers seconded the motion to approve the
artwork as proposed. The motion carried by the following vote:

3 18-0365 Study Issue Process Overview
Senior Management Analyst, Lupita Alamos from the City Manager’s Office shared a
presentation of the City’s Study Issue Process. During the presentation, Ms. Alamos
spoke about the study issue process timeline, who can propose a study issue and
how study issues should be policy related and not operational. Ms. Alamos
discussed the role of the boards and commissions in the study issue process,
information on public input and the City Council's role and responsibilities.
Temporary Chair Kiphuth asked about a deferred study issues proposed by the Arts
Commission on painting utility boxes and potentially including it in the Master Plan
for Public Art. Superintendent Wax replied that the utility box painting proposal
would need to be resubmitted as a study issue and go through the study issue
process again since a deferred study issue does not automatically come back to the
Commission annually.
Commissioner Eskridge asked if the proposal from Ms. Sweet from Kings Academy
on the school's utility boxes painting project in Sunnyvale was similar to the study
issue proposal that was deferred. Superintendent Wax replied that the school
project was similar in subject but not related to the deferred study issue proposed
City of Sunnyvale Page 3
Arts Commission Meeting Minutes - Final April 18, 2018
by the Arts Commission. Mr. Wax also mentioned that the upcoming Master Plan for
Public Art may have some reference or statement related to art on utility boxes in
the City.
